Abstract

The computation of the mean perimeter density via the notion of mean covariogram for non-stationary Boolean models has been proposed as further work in Galerne (Image Anal. Stereol. 30 (2011) 39–51). We address this issue by considering here more general germ-grain models. Furthermore, we discuss similarities and differences with respect to the computation of the mean boundary density by means of the outer Minkowski content notion.
